Part Details
- ±15kV (Human Body Model) ESD Protection, on COM_
- Fully Specified for a Single +2.7V to +3.6V Power-Supply Voltage
- Low 4Ω (typ), 7Ω (max) On-Resistance (RON)
- -3dB Bandwidth: 500MHz (typ)
- Low Bit-to-Bit Skew ≤ 20ps
- Charge-Pump Noise = 90µV (typ)
- Charge-Pump Enable
- No Need for Logic-Level Shifters for 1.4V or Above
- COM_ Analog Inputs Fault-Protected Against Shorts to USB Supply Rail Up to +5.5V
- Low Supply Current 3µA (max) in Standby
- Space-Saving 10-Pin, 2mm x 2mm µDFN Package
The MAX4906EF are electrostatic discharge (ESD)-protected analog switches that combine low on-capacitance (CON) and low on-resistance (RON) necessary for high-performance switching applications. The COM_ inputs are protected against ±15kV ESD without latchup or damage. The device is designed for USB 2.0 high-speed applications at 480Mbps. The switches also handle all the requirements for USB low- and full-speed signaling.
The MAX4906EF features two single-pole/double-throw (SPDT) switches. The device is fully specified to operate from a single +2.7V to +3.6V power supply and is protected against a +5.5V short to all analog inputs (COM_, NC_, NO_). This feature makes the MAX4906EF fully compliant with the USB 2.0 specification of +5.5V fault protection. The device features a low threshold voltage and a +1.4V VIH, permitting them to be used with low-voltage logic. The device features a active-low QP input that when driven high, turns the charge pump off and sets the device in standby mode. When the device is in standby mode, the quiescent supply current is reduced to 3µA (max) and the switches remain operable.
The MAX4906EF is available in a space-saving, 2mm x 2mm µDFN package and operates over a -40°C to +85°C temperature range.
